Real-World Scenario

Diesel gelling in freezing temperatures? Diesel fuel contains paraffin wax that crystallises in extreme cold, blocking fuel filters and preventing the engine from starting. We carry fuel additives and can clear blocked filters at your door to get you moving.

What NOT to Do

Don't repeatedly crank the engine when it won't start — you'll drain the battery completely and may damage the starter motor. Three attempts maximum, then call us.

Equipment We Carry

For home starts, we bring professional-grade lithium jump packs capable of starting even large diesel engines, battery testing equipment that checks both cranking amps and charging system health, and a selection of the most common replacement batteries for fitting on the spot.
